Description

Given a UEFI image as input, this tool quantifies how easy it is to insert and debug a LinuxBoot kernel. Here is a starting list of rules which can be easily checked:

Rule | Description
-- | --
Allowed Firmware Volumes | At most 4 firmware volumes are allowed: PEI, UEFI (DXEs, APPs, etc.), NVRAM, NVRAM backup
No Misplaced Files | The PEI firmware volume may not contain any DXE blobs. The DXE firmware volume may not contain any PEI blobs.
Free Space | The DXE Firmware Volume must have at least 8 megabytes of uncompressed free space.
Compression Method | The firmware volume containing DXEs is either uncompressed or compressed with standard LZMA compression. The protocol GUID for LZMA compression is EE4E5898-3914-4259-9D6E-DC7BD79403CF.
GUID Names | Prefer that DXEs contain a descriptive name in their USER_INTERFACE sections.

When a rule fails, the output describes which rule failed and what can be changed to fix it.
